The team of the week tradition traces to the football media’s need for weekly highlights. Outlets like LeaderLive have run such features for years, starting with print editions in North Wales and expanding online.

LeaderLive, part of the Newsquest Media Group, covers Wrexham and the surrounding areas with a focus on local and national sport. Their sports desk, active since the paper’s relaunch, compiles XIs to engage fans amid packed schedules.
